BROWN COUNTY, WI (WTAQ) – The daughter of a state legislator is being found guilty of supplying drugs that killed a pregnant woman back in June 2017.
Cassie Nygren pleaded no contest Tuesday to a number of charges, but a Brown County judge entered guilty pleas instead. That was part of an agreement with prosecutors.
Nygren was found guilty of charges including being party to a first-degree reckless homicide. Other charges were dismissed, including a first-degree reckless homicide for the baby’s death and neglecting a child.
Sentencing is set for February 17th.
